Water line excavation services involve digging trenches or holes to access, repair, or replace the underground water supply lines that deliver water to a property. This process typically requires careful planning and precise excavation to avoid damaging existing utilities or structures. Skilled contractors use specialized equipment to carefully expose the water lines, allowing for repairs or upgrades to be performed efficiently and safely. These services are essential when the water line is damaged, leaking, or needs to be rerouted due to property renovations or new construction projects.

This service helps address a variety of common problems homeowners may experience with their water systems. Signs such as low water pressure, frequent leaks, or unexplained water bills can indicate issues with underground water lines. In some cases, corrosion, tree root intrusion, or shifting soil can cause pipes to crack or break. When these problems occur, excavation is often necessary to locate the affected sections of pipe, remove damaged portions, and install new lines. Proper excavation ensures that repairs are thorough and long-lasting, reducing the likelihood of future issues.

The overview below groups typical Water Line Excavation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Worcester, MA.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- For minor water line repairs, local contractors typically charge between $250 and $600. Many routine fixes fall within this range, depending on the extent of the damage and accessibility.

Partial Replacement - Replacing a section of a water line usually costs between $1,000 and $3,000. Projects of this size are common and can vary based on pipe material and site conditions.

Full Line Replacement - Complete water line replacements in Worcester-area homes often range from $3,500 to $8,000. Larger or more complex jobs can exceed this range, especially if additional excavation or permits are required.

Major or Emergency Projects - Extensive water line excavations or emergency repairs can reach $10,000 or more. These projects are less frequent but may involve significant excavation and specialized equipment.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
